随着加密货币的普及,对于数字资产的安全存储成为越来越多投资者关注的焦点。冷钱包作为一种安全性极高的数字...
如果你对以太坊(Ethereum)有所了解,那你肯定听说过测试网。就像一个足球小队在正式比赛前会进行训练一样,Goerli测试网正是给开发者一个练习和测试的地方。大家都知道测试网的好处,大多数时候,你在这里进行各种操作都不花钱。对,完全免费!Goerli是几个以太坊测试网中的一个,支持不同的客户端,让开发者和用户能够更加灵活地进行各种实验。
那么Goerli到底有什么特别的地方呢?首先,它是一个开源的测试网,允许各种不同的以太坊客户端进行运行。这意味着你在Goerli上实验,不受某个特定客户端的限制,增强了技术的多样性。
其次,Goerli还是一个联合网络,它的分布式验证机制意味着你存储和发出的每个交易,都是在社区的监督下进行的。所以,相比其他测试网,Goerli能够更好地模拟主网的环境。
作为一个开发者或用户,Goerli给我们提供了一个低风险的环境来测试代码、合约或DApp(去中心化应用)。你不会因为一时的疏忽而损失真金白银的信息。记得我第一次测试NFT合约的时候,心里紧张得不行,生怕出错。可是,在Goerli上我可以肆无忌惮地反复试错,从中学习。
此外,Goerli还支持各种与以太坊上的DApp集成的工具和框架,比如Hardhat、Truffle等等。这让我们开发人员在创建和测试精密的合约时变得更加高效。
你准备好尝试Goerli了吗?其实很简单!以下是我个人的步骤,分享给大家:
说到Goerli水龙头,我记得我第一次去领测试币的时候,差点没瞎晕过去。每个网站的使用方式不同,有些需要Twitter账号,有些又要求加入Telegram群。可算是摸爬滚打,最后还是领到了币。不过那时候的体验有些复杂,可能对新手会有点考验。不过现在已经改善了很多,很多水龙头的使用都变得更加人性化了。
说说我的实战经历吧。前几个月,我跟几个小伙伴一起开发了一个去中心化的投票系统。我们当时的目标是在Goerli上先把功能齐全,模拟真实的投票过程。我记得那个时候,我们互相之间鼓励、讨论,简直就是热闹得不得了。
最开始的时候,一切都很顺利。我们创建了合约,成功部署到了Goerli上,大家都在看合约的变化,觉得非常兴奋。然而,随着我们逐渐深入开发,突然发现我们在合约的某处逻辑上出现了bug。那个时候,我们几乎都傻了,想着“完了,直奔主网会出大事”。不过,在Goerli上调试就没那么糟糕。经过一番探讨,我们很快定位了问题并进行修改,又重新部署了一遍,这时的心情就像过了考试,轻松不少。
提到测试网,不得不说说Rinkeby、Ropsten等其他测试网。不同的测试网有不同的特点,比如Ropsten是完全的公开网络,允许任何人进行挖矿和验证,但相对更容易遭受攻击。Rinkeby则是一个更加安全的网络,但需要依赖于Proof of Authority(PoA)机制,开发者的使用灵活性小一些。
相比之下,Goerli算是一个折中的选择。既能提供安全性,又不会让开发者受限。如果你是新手或小团队,Goerli似乎是个不错的选择,可以在实战中提升自己的技能。
随着以太坊的发展,Goerli测试网也在不断完善。我认为,在未来,我们会看到越来越多的开发者和项目选择Goerli作为测试和实验的环境。毕竟,去中心化的方式,能够让我们的产品在真正上线之前,经过多方测试,提升稳定性和安全性。
当然,这一切的前提是,开发者要善用这些测试环境,勇于探索,用技术推动自己的想法。花费时间在Goerli上探索可以让你更有信心去面对主网的挑战。
总之,把Goerli当成是你进入区块链世界的一扇窗。它是一块试验田,让你在这里不断耕耘,播种,收获。而每一次在Goerli上的实验,都会让你对以太坊的理解更深,更透彻。
用心去体验,相信你会得到很大的收获,也许下一个独特的项目,就是从这里起步的!